Wait and requeue if LB is in PENDING_DELETE
If the LB that is being deleted when a cluster is deleted, it'll go through the PENDING_DELETE state and at this stage there is nothing we can do but wait for the LB to be actually deleted. If the LB is in that state during the deletion, let's just return no error but request a reconcile after some time.
